I was walking in the snowy countryside the other day. I had my ClipSport on shuffle & the song "Good" by Supreme Beings of Leisure came up. It was really "Good". It made me think.
I know we all do it, have some music, some band that we love at some time in some space, then the mood, the moment, the meaning changes...we move on & then we forget. That was definitely Supreme Beings of Leisure. I used to listen to them regularly but then I moved on to other tastes & they slipped away.
Having just done a month of female artists, my ears were still keen to that particular XX sound. Geri Soriano-Lightwood, the singer for SBoL, definitely has it in spades. But the band only released three albums between 2000 & 2008. Then disappeared off the grid.
The light bulb flashed on above my cranium & I realized this is perfect mega-post material. Let's dig in.

Supreme Beings of Leisure
Supreme Beings of Leisure (SBL) are an electronic/trip hop grupp from Los Angeles, California. Current members of SBL are singer/songwriter Geri Soriano-Lightwood, multi-instrumentalist/producer Ramin Sakurai, and guitarist/programmer Rick Torres. SBL was formed from the remains of the grupp Oversoul 7 in 1998 when they signed to Palm Pictures. [1]
History
[edit]In 1996, Oversoul 7 formed with singer Geri Soriano-Lightwood, Ramin Sakurai, bassist Kiran Shahani, and guitarist Rick Torres, and released "Nothing Like Tomorrow" and "What's the Deal" on two compilations on the Moonshine Music dance label.
